About Quicktion 2.0

Quicktion 2.0 is a powerful productivity tool designed to streamline email management and organization by seamlessly routing emails into your favorite workspace apps. Originally launched in 2023 as a simple Gmail add-on that saved emails directly to Notion, Quicktion has evolved significantly into a multi-platform integration engine.

With Quicktion 2.0, users can save emails to six major destinations: Notion, Google Sheets, Google Drive, Airtable, Linear, and Trello. What sets this version apart is its universal compatibility—every destination is assigned its own unique forwarding address. This means whether you are using Outlook, Apple Mail, or any other email client, your messages can automatically file themselves upon arrival.

For advanced users, the Pro tier introduces intelligent AI capabilities. By writing a simple custom prompt, the AI automatically extracts specific fields from the email body and any attached PDFs. Whether you need to pull invoice numbers, financial totals, specific dates, or custom data points, Quicktion 2.0 does the heavy lifting for you.

About trustyourinbox

TrustYourInbox is a streamlined DMARC monitoring solution built specifically for individuals, creators, and teams who do not have dedicated security analysts. While traditional DMARC tools rely on complex raw XML files, endless dashboards, and enterprise-level pricing, TrustYourInbox simplifies domain email security by identifying senders and translating raw reports into plain, easy-to-understand English.

Designed to save time, the platform eliminates the need for constant dashboard checking by delivering a single 60-second digest every day. To reduce technical risk when modifying records, TrustYourInbox features one-click DNS fixes equipped with a built-in 5-minute hold and a 24-hour undo safety net.

For modernized workflows, TrustYourInbox integrates directly into everyday tools. It supports fix approvals directly inside Slack and features a full Model Context Protocol (MCP) server. This allows AI environments such as Claude or Cursor to answer questions using your actual domain data. TrustYourInbox offers a free forever plan with full product access for one domain, with paid plans available at $9 and $19 for managing additional domains.
